Men's Experience of Prostate Biopsy
Managing the Experience of Prostate Biopsy: What Are Men's Perceptions of Their Lived Experience and Support Needs

Brief Summary
Men aged over 18 having a first or second diagnostic prostate biopsy at the Royal Marsden NHS Foundation Trust or Epsom General Hospital may be invited to take part in one to one interview within 6 months of having the procedure done to talk about their experience

Eligibility Criteria
Men aged over 18
You may qualify if:
- Men aged over 18 having a first or second diagnostic prostate biopsy at either the Royal Marsden NHS Foundation Trust or Epsom General Hospital
- Within 6 months of their prostate biopsy being done
You may not qualify if:
- Men unable to give informed consent/ men needing a translator
